         | dhosek wrote:
         | One of the big complaints about Han-unification in Unicode is
         | that simplified and traditional forms share the same code
         | points so display of simplified vs traditional is up to the
         | font to manage.
        
           | renhanxue wrote:
           | That's not really accurate. An overwhelming majority of the
           | simplified characters have had their own code points in
           | Unicode ever since 1.0. Some more details here:
           | https://r12a.github.io/scripts/chinese/

         | mbrubeck wrote:
         | Can you clarify which characters you're talking about? I don't
         | see any examples of Japanese-specific kanji in the simplified
         | Chinese examples.
         | 
         | For example, the first image uses Gou  and Shi  forms that are
         | found only in simplified Chinese. In both Japanese and
         | traditional Chinese, these are written Gou  and Shi .
         | 
         | The images also correctly use the Chinese forms of Tong /Tong .
         | The Japanese form [0] differs from both and does not appear in
         | these images.
         | 
         | Qing  as shown in the image is similarly used only in
         | simplified Chinese, not Japanese. In Japanese, the traditional
         | Chinese form is normally used in handwriting, and an alternate
         | form of the Yan  radical (different from either of the Chinese
         | forms) is often used in printed text.
